MAPP is a lively, old-school Mission-wide party, well-attended by folks from the neighborhood and afar, with bimonthly events all over the Mission for over 15 years. MAPP is dedicated to cultivating, building and defending the culture, history, character and community in the Mission District—transforming public spaces, non-profits, street corners, BART stations, cafes, bars, taquerias, garages and homes, into venues with free live music, spoken word, performance art, film screenings, delicious food, and a wide range of unique happenings.

Explore the mind-body connection, decrease stress, increase mental and physical fitness (resilience, strength, endurance, balance, coordination, flexibility, memory), and become part of our community while exploring a variety of somatic, fitness, and dance modalities. Activities include chair and standing yoga, Tai Chi Chih, Tai Chi for Arthritis and Fall Prevention, breathing exercises, light weight lifting, modified ballet barre, mindful movement, seated meditation, and more. Each class includes a short talk about a topic based on feedback from students. Let me know if you have a topic you would like to have discussed.
